How much do program development ass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for program development assistant in North Attleboro, MA is $21.47,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.26 and $23.65 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a program development assistant?

A Program Development Assistant is a professional who supports the creation, planning, and implementation of programs within an organization. Their responsibilities often include conducting research, helping with program design, coordinating logistics, and assisting with documentation and reporting. They work closely with program managers and other team members to ensure that programs meet organizational goals and run smoothly. This role is common in nonprofit organizations, educational institutions, and various corporate sectors.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a program development assistant?

To thrive as a Program Development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a background in project coordination, often supported by a bachelor’s degree in a relevant field. Familiarity with project management software, data analysis tools, and pro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ite are commonly required. Strong communication, problem-solving, and teamwork abilities distinguish top performers in this role. These skills are vital for effectively supporting program planning, execution, and evaluation, ensuring project goals are met efficiently.

What are some common challenges faced by program development assistants, and how can they be addressed?

Program Development Assistants often juggle multiple projects and deadlines, which can make time management a significant challenge. They may also need to coordinate with diverse stakeholders, requiring strong communication and organizational skills. To address these challenges, it's helpful to develop effective prioritization strategies, maintain clear documentation, and proactively seek clarification when project objectives are unclear. Building strong relationships with team members and leveraging project management tools can also contribute to smoother workflows and successful program outcomes.

What is the difference between Program Development Assistant vs Program Coordinator?

AspectProgram Development AssistantProgram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in related fieldUsually requires a bachelor's degree; some roles prefer experience or certifications
Work EnvironmentSupports program planning and development teams, often in office settingsOversees program implementation, liaising with stakeholders and managing logistics
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in nonprofit, government, and educational sectorsFound in similar sectors, often with more responsibility for execution

The Program Development Assistant primarily supports the planning and development of programs, focusing on research and preparation. In contrast, the Program Coordinator manages the execution and coordination of programs, ensuring smooth operation.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ds but differ in scope and responsibilities.
